The AP Test �(This Test Is a Monster!)

  • 3 Hour Test

Part 1 = Multiple Choice Test, 55-60 Questions, 4-5 passages, (old and new), anything from 16th Century Literature to Contemporary Literature: One Hour

Part 2= 3 Essay Questions (40 minutes each—2 Hours)

  1. Poetry Response
  2. Prose Response
  3. Open Response (Choose a Favorite Work of Literary Merit)
